Ditlhase moves close to 50-Overs final
19 Aug 2014
Ditlhase have moved close to reaching the final of the BCA 50-Overs Regional Tournament after claiming a 25 runs victory over Shining Stars at the Cricket Oval on August 17.
It was Ditlhase’s second win in a row after last weekend’s eight wickets victory over Southern Rocks, while Stars were suffering their first defeat.
As things stand, Ditlhase lead the four team southern region standings and a win over Tladi this Sunday will guarantee them a first place finish at the end of the round robin. The top two finishers are set to contest the final on 7 September in Gaborone.
Stars won the toss on Sunday but elected to bat last, giving Ditlhase an opportunity to amass 224 runs in 48.1 overs of the first innings. Ditlhase’s best batsmen Reginald Nehonde and Noor Ahmed each completed 45 runs.
With a target of 224 runs to chase, Stars endured a horrible start to the second innings as Ditlhase’s fast bowler Namal Bandara claimed Rashaad Mosweu’s wicket with his first ball.
Though the youngsters recovered and strung good rate of six runs per over through the partnership of Tumelo Molema and Obakeng Eyman, they were dealt another blow in the 13th over when they three wickets in quick succession.
Molema was run-out by Noor Ahmed while Inzimam Master was caught by Alaap Shah after facing a single ball.
Then Eyman was bowled out by Katlego Thuto in the 15th over, but Stars managed to regroup and passed the 100 runs mark in the 19th over.
But with Ditlhase’s fast bowlers getting the better of Stars’s batsmen, Stars continued to lose more wickets without making the enough ground on their opponents score and were finally all-out when Thabang Nsomane was bowled out by Assim Siddiqui in the 45th over.
Stars are now forced to win their next match to ensure qualification to the final. ENDS
